Clydes Spring is a spring in Utah, at a modelled 1,662 m. Lands End stands 2,171 m to the south, 21 miles off. The nearest named place is Clyde Point, a peak 1.1 miles away. Dead Horse Point Mesa Scenic Byway passes 16 miles off.
